WebApr 17, 2024 · April 17, 2024. Ame Vanorio. For those who avoid eating the turkey skin at Thanksgiving, it may be tempting to throw some to your dog. Turkey skin itself isn’t toxic to dogs, however it can have adverse effects. The high fat content of the skin can be hard on a dog’s stomach, leading to stomach pain and possible pancreatitis.
